Social media content scheduling and cross-platform syndication

Purpose

1. Streamline the process of planning, scheduling, and publishing event-related content across multiple social media and entertainment platforms for amphitheater venues.

2. Ensure synchronized promotional campaigns, announcements, and behind-the-scenes content reach targeted audiences on their preferred channels.

3. Enhance audience engagement by maintaining consistent visibility before, during, and after events.

4. Minimize manual posting errors and delays by automating cross-platform syndication.

5. Systematically track content performance and engagement analytics.


Trigger Conditions

1. Scheduled event date reaches X days prior (configurable, e.g., 7 days before show).

2. New marketing content asset is uploaded or approved.

3. Changes or updates to event lineup, ticket availability, or weather alerts.

4. Social campaign approval status is marked as “Go Live.”

5. Scheduled recurring time (e.g., every Friday at 11:00 AM for “Weekend Events Spotlight”).


Platform Variants

1. Facebook Pages

 • Feature/Setting: Scheduled Post API (Graph API endpoint: /{page-id}/feed, “scheduled_publish_time”).

2. Instagram

 • Feature/Setting: Instagram Content Publishing API (“/media” endpoint with scheduled publish parameter).

3. Twitter (X)

 • Feature/Setting: Tweet Scheduler via v2/tweets API and third-party scheduling endpoints.

4. LinkedIn

 • Feature/Setting: Share API (“/ugcPosts” endpoint, with schedule_time parameter via partner).

5. TikTok

 • Feature/Setting: Business Content Posting API, video scheduling parameter.

6. YouTube

 • Feature/Setting: YouTube Data API v3, Videos: insert with “publishAt” scheduled datetime.

7. Pinterest

 • Feature/Setting: Content Scheduler via /pins endpoint with “publish_at” property.

8. Reddit

 • Feature/Setting: “/api/submit” endpoint for scheduled post to relevant forums.

9. Snapchat

 • Feature/Setting: Snapchat Ads API, Snap Publisher for post scheduling.

10. Tumblr

 • Feature/Setting: “/v2/blog/{blog-identifier}/post” with “publish_on” timestamp.
